Output 63b05060ef51879f307867edef4dce69dd39b934ad2be532d51b62753ae440a7:21

value
316941
script pubkey
OP_0 OP_PUSHBYTES_20 43f878ea48314d3a4f872c269d1aa05a5a8bd3d9
address
bc1qg0u836jgx9xn5nu89snf6x4qtfdgh57e7nx2qq
transaction
63b05060ef51879f307867edef4dce69dd39b934ad2be532d51b62753ae440a7
spent
true